ORNG Red Card Certification
Oregon National Guard Public Affairs Office
July 24, 2020 | 5:50
Approximately 400 Oregon National Guardsman completed wildland firefighter training to receive their "Red Card", June 11-17, 2020 in Salem, Ore. The training was provided by the Oregon Department of Public Safety Standards and Training (DPSST). The Oregon National Guard (ORNG) has an ongoing agrement with the Oregon Department fo Forestry, called Operation Plan Smokey, that dictates how the ORNG can be used to assist the state in fighting fires. Since 2015, Oregon has called upon 2,148 ORNG members to assist in protecting it's citizens and communites from wildfires.
